730 21st Street Northwest has a Walk Score of 98 out of 100. This location is a Walker’s Paradise so daily errands do not require a car.
730 21st Street Northwest is a six minute walk from the BL Blue, the OR Orange and the SV Silver at the FOGGY BOTTOM-GWU, BLUE/ORANGE/SILVER LINE CENTER PLATFORM stop.
This location is in the Foggy Bottom - GWU - West End neighborhood in Washington, DC. Nearby parks include Kogan Plaza, Ascension Sculpture and Alexander Pushkin Monument.
